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ction
Ignoring the warning signs of behind-the-wall water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Look out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strange smells can show a hidden water leak behind the walls. Don’t ignore these odors; they can be a sign of a more serious problem.
Warped or Discolored Drywall
Water damage can cause drywall to become discolored or warped. This is a clear sign that you need behind wall water extraction services.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
Water stains on the ceiling can show a leak behind the walls. Don’t ignore these stains; they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Peeling or Buckling Paint
Peeling or buckling paint can be a sign of water damage behind the walls. This is a clear indication that you need behind wall water extraction services.

Common Questions About Behind Wall Water Extraction
How long does behind wall water extraction take?
The length of time it takes to complete behind wall water extraction dep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from a few hours to several days.
What causes behind wall water damage?
Behind wall water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ks in the roof, walls, or floors, as well as burst pipes or appliance malfunctions.

What’s the best way to prevent behind wall water damage?
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ent behind wall water damage. Check for signs of water damage, such as musty odors or warping drywall, and address any issues quickly.
